![](https://img-blog.csdnimg.cn/e3037c36f7ae4cad83addbfd856c5665.jpeg?x-oss-process=image/resize,m_fixed,h_224,w_224)
Android Studio
文章平均质量分 51
Android Studio
书启秋枫
手痒了,写代码!
展开
-
Android studio 2021版安装与配置
1.Android Studio 软件下载官网下载地址:https://developer.android.google.cn/studio/点击DOWNLODAD 下载:下载好安装包2.点击进行安装,依次出现以下界面3.这里Android studio程序安装完毕,但是还需要继续对其进行配置; 勾选Start Android Studio,然后点击finish启动Android studio,出现下图4.这个界面,是提示是否导入...原创 2022-02-28 22:10:57 · 8098 阅读 · 0 评论 -
Android studio基础练习01【按钮实现下拉菜单】
2. 拖拽准备工作完成后,进行右边Attributes设置更改。5. 放心运行项目,显示成果。4. DeBug调试运行。1. 手动拖拽实现功能键。原创 2022-02-28 22:31:53 · 5108 阅读 · 0 评论 -
Android studio基础练习02【监听器实现下拉菜单】
是用来将定义好的Toast显示在MainActivity里的,如果不调用.show();方法定义的Toast就没有任何意义。表示Toast的显示时间一微秒计算,这里调用系统定义好扥时间,也可自己写入确定的时间。自己定义的文本,表示引用string下的文本的资源;是为了提醒用户,而又不影响用户的操作的提示栏。表示在MainActivity这个文件里显示;注:Spinner组件不支持item。在后面的引号中输入想输出的文本。1. 手动拖拽实现功能键。,即Spinner的。原创 2022-03-04 16:51:05 · 3240 阅读 · 0 评论 -
Android studio基础练习03【miniQuiz初阶题目问答实现】
关于一个刷题软件的简易功能实现自己建项目名GeoQuiz , 不多说了,直接上代码了。。。1. activity_quiz.xml布局及代码<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to"原创 2022-03-07 16:18:20 · 3350 阅读 · 0 评论 -
Android studio基础练习04【两页面之间的跳转】
一、结构搭建二、代码实现 AndroidManifest.xml<?xml version="1.0" encoding="utf-8"?><man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.suke.messager"> <application android:allowBackup="true" .原创 2022-03-28 21:36:37 · 3077 阅读 · 0 评论 -
Android studio基础练习05【时钟日志】
一、结构搭建二、代码实现 activity_main.xml<?xml version="1.0" encoding="utf-8"?><androidx.constraintlayout.widget.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" .原创 2022-03-28 21:43:11 · 3512 阅读 · 0 评论 -
Android studio基础练习06【PoolWater】
一、结构搭建二、代码实现activity_main.xml<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" androi原创 2022-05-23 13:24:47 · 385 阅读 · 0 评论 -
Android studio基础练习07【获取手机通讯录】
一、结构搭建二、代码实现AndroidManifest.xml<?xml version="1.0" encoding="utf-8"?><man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.suke.getnameandphone"> <application android:allowBackup="tru.原创 2022-05-23 13:51:23 · 2755 阅读 · 3 评论 -
实验二 GeoQuiz进阶
一、实验要内容题目:Android MVC模式1. 除了课堂上介绍的设置的监听器的方法,还有哪些办法实现按钮的响应?2. 增加两个按钮(prev,next)实现问题的遍历。3. 问题描述已经分离在资源文件中,如何将answer也分离在资源文件中?4. 如果要增加新的问题及其答案,是否需要修改Java代码?能否不修改Java代码,仅修改资源文件就实现增加新的问题。提示:Array类型的资源.5. 用户答完某题后,禁掉对应题目的True和False作答按钮,即,一个题目只允许作答一次;6. 用原创 2022-03-28 14:14:10 · 886 阅读 · 0 评论 -
实验三 Acitivy生命周期管理【GeoQuiz高阶】
一、实验要内容1. 请给MiniQuiz增加一个Activity,在这个新增的Activity提示答案;2. 再新增一个Activty,答完最后一个题目的时候,提示用户一共回答正确和错误的汇总情况,以及使用了提示答案的情况;再这个新增的Acity中共用户选择“退出程序”或者“重新开始答题”。3. 在整个运行过程中,请使用Log显示Activity生命周期状态变化,并在实验报告中分析其状态变化的条件和原因。4.在以上程序运行的过程中,进行横屏和竖屏的切换,要求,无论程序在什么时候切换,都可以原创 2022-03-28 21:24:18 · 1975 阅读 · 6 评论 -
实验四 Android项目CriminalIntent应用开发一
一、项目创建二、代码详情 1. values布局(1)strings.xml<resources> <string name="app_name">学号+姓名</string> <string name="hello_blank_fragment">Hello blank fragment</string></resources>2. layout布局(1)activity原创 2022-04-05 11:16:36 · 1210 阅读 · 3 评论 -
实验四 Android项目CriminalIntent应用开发二
参考文章:第二个项目CriminalIntent应用开发阶段总结(一)(二)https://www.cnblogs.com/hj0407/android编程权威指南第七章-CriminalIntent应用https://blog.csdn.net/weixin_43749381/article/details/107465847Android Criminal实例--(1)创建fragment并添加至activityhttps://blog.csdn.net/ayangann915/artic.原创 2022-04-05 11:51:05 · 2855 阅读 · 0 评论 -
实验五 Android Studio ListView列表视图【班级名单列表视图01】
一、实验目的深入学习Fragment的用法,自定义列表视图的实现。二、实验要内容实现一个班级名单的列表视图 每个列表项包含:个人照片,学号和姓名,电话; 可以删除列表项,添加列表项; 可以从列表项拨打对应的电话号码。 三、结构搭建三、代码实现 activity_main.xml<?xml version="1.0" encoding="utf-8"?><androidx.constraintlayout.widge.原创 2022-04-21 23:09:04 · 4840 阅读 · 18 评论 -
实验五 Android Studio RecyclerView列表视图【班级名单列表视图01】
一、实验目的深入学习Fragment的用法,自定义列表(RecyclerView)视图的实现。二、实验内容实现一个班级名单的列表视图 每个列表项包含:个人照片,学号和姓名,电话; 可以删除列表项,添加列表项; 可以从列表项拨打对应的电话号码。 三、结构搭建四、代码实现activity_main.xml<?xml version="1.0" encoding="utf-8"?><androidx.constraint.原创 2022-05-23 14:42:38 · 1950 阅读 · 0 评论 -
实验六 Android Studio SQLite数据存储和访问【班级名单列表视图02】
一、实验目的SQLite数据存储和访问。二、实验内容将班级名单以SQLite的方式保存在本地1. 每个列表项包含:学号和姓名,电话;2. 可以删除列表项,添加列表项(数据更新到SQLite数据库);3. 可以读取联系人(使用内容提供者),将联系人的名字和电话号码读入到名单列表并插入数据库;4. 支持在新的页面中学号和姓名,电话。三、结构搭建四、代码实现AndroidManifest.xml<uses-permission android:na原创 2022-05-23 14:29:35 · 2737 阅读 · 0 评论 -
实验七 Android Studio Intent相机图库读取照片【班级名单列表视图03】
一、实验目的掌握Intent启动外部应用并交互数据的方法,了解Android权限和访问外部文件的方法。二、实验内容在SQLite版本的班级名单基础上实现以下功能1. 设计修改列表项的Fragment页面,支持调用相机和读取图库中照片;2. 将拍摄的或选中的照片设置为该名单对应的头像,并在列表中更新显示;3. 将名单和图片文件的对应关系保存在SQLite数据库中,下次重启应用的时候可以看到名单的头像;三、结构搭建导入图片四、代码实现AndroidManif.原创 2022-05-23 15:11:18 · 2244 阅读 · 1 评论